Posting Details Position Details Posting Number G/R02385P Working Title Postdoctoral Associate AD Department CAES-Plant Pathology About the University of Georgia Since our founding in 1785, the University of Georgia has operated as Georgia's oldest, most comprehensive, and most diversified institution of higher education (). The proof is in our more than 235 years of academic and professional achievements and our continual commitment to higher education. UGA is currently ranked among the top 20 public universities in U.S. News & World Report. The University's main campus is located in Athens, approximately 65 miles northeast of Atlanta, with extended campuses in Atlanta, Griffin, Gwinnett, and Tifton. UGA employs approximately 3,000 faculty and more than 7,700 full-time staff. The University's enrollment exceeds 40,000 students including over 30,000 undergraduates and over 10,000 graduate and professional students. Academic programs reside in 18 schools and colleges, as well as a medical partnership with Augusta University housed on the UGA Health Sciences Campus in Athens. Duties/Responsibilities Duties/Responsibilities Develop assays for the rapid molecular detection of azole-resistant strains of Aspergillus fumigatus in environmental samples and monitor antifungal resistance of human pathogens in agricultural environments. Percentage of time 75 Duties/Responsibilities Communicate regularly with the PI regarding research and other issues relevant to the project. Percentage of time 10 Duties/Responsibilities Present results to the scientific community and for publication in peer-reviewed journals. Percentage of time 10 Duties/Responsibilities Train graduate students, undergraduate students, and other researchers in the lab on methods and techniques as needed. Percentage of time 5 More...
